What is meta ppgf charge

Meta partners exclusively with PayPal Giving Fund (PPGF) for our fundraising products in the US, UK, Canada and Australia. In these markets, when you want to donate or raise money for a charity, you will be donating to PPGF, which will then distribute donations to the benefitting organisation. Click here for more details.Fundraising on Facebook (update for fall 2023) Beginning October 31, 2023, Meta is partnering with PayPal Giving Fund (PPGF) to support donations benefiting nonprofits in the United States, United Kingdom, Australia, and Canada. Facebook also no longer covers processing fees but allows donors to cover the cost.
